Read moreNigeria out of recession as Q4 2020 GDP grew by 0.11%
Nigeria has exited recession after the gross domestic product (GDP) grew by a marginal 0.11 per cent in Q4. The figures are contained in the GDP growth report released by the National Bureau of Statistics (NBS) today. With several headwinds, however, the growth remains fragile. Read moreNigeria ranks 149 out of 180 countries on transparency, worst since 2015
A report released Thursday by Transparency International has ranked Nigeria at 149 out of 180 countries on transparency, its worst performance since President Muhammadu Buhari came to power in 2015. The 2020 Transparency International corruption perception index showed that Nigeria scored 25 out of 100 points.
